The number 0.1 can be represented in binary as 0.00011001100110011 . The pattern of 0011 repeats infinitely. We cant store the binary equivalent of decimal 0.1 . As we know, 0.1 is equal to 1/10 .
Binary describes a numbering scheme in which there are only two possible values for each digit -- 0 or 1 -- and is the basis for all binary code used in computing systems. These systems use this code to understand operational instructions and user input and to present a relevant output to the user.
In computer applications, where binary numbers are represented by only two symbols or digits, i.e. 0 (zero) and 1(one). The binary numbers here are expressed in the base-2 numeral system. For example, (101)2 is a binary number. Each digit in this system is said to be a bit.
1. In which numbering system can the binary number 1011011111000101 be easily converted to? Explanation: Hexadecimal system is better, because each 4-digit binary represents one Hexadecimal digit.

Adding 0 and 1, we get 1 (no carry). That means the last digit of the answer will be one. Then we move one digit to the left: adding 1 and 1 we get 10. Hence, the answer is 101.
The numbers from 0 to 10 are thus in binary 0, 1, 10, 11, 100, 101, 110, 111, 1000, 1001, and 1010.
